Has anybody experienced that a change in brands of hydroxychloroquine has not been as effective? I usually take Plaquenil (I live in Australia). Due to the pandemic and also due to an entrepreneur buying up all supplies of Plaquenil in past months I had to swap to Hequinel’ brand, as Plaquenil was not available. I’ve been extremely fatigued for the last few weeks and am now thinking the worsening fatigue may have started with the change in hydroxychloroquine brands. Has anybody else experienced this?
